What You Will Do

What to expect

You will be fully supported in your role, learning on the job whilst also being given paid time to study for your Level 5 teaching qualification (fully funded). This is a two-year training contract, however if you successfully complete your teaching qualification, a permanent role will be offered on completion.

About You

Entry Requirements

  • New to teaching and not already hold any teaching qualifications.
  • To have, or be willing to work towards, a Level 2 qualification in English and maths.
  • For technical subjects, a Level 3 qualification (or higher) in a relevant field is desirable.
  • For technical subjects, industry experience is desirable.
